稳格智造 CAN 通信上位机开发服务:工业数据交互的智慧桥梁
在工业自动化与物联网深度融合的当下,CAN(Controller Area Network)通信凭借其高可靠性、实时性和多主通信能力,成为工业设备互联的核心技术。稳格智造凭借多年工业软件开发经验,推出专业 CAN 通信上位机开发服务,通过协议解析、数据采集、远程监控与智能分析等功能,助力企业实现设备互联、数据驱动决策与智能化升级。
一、CAN 通信:工业现场的“神经中枢”
CAN 总线诞生于汽车电子领域,后广泛应用于工业自动化、医疗设备、轨道交通等场景。其核心优势在于:
高可靠性:采用差分信号传输与非破坏性仲裁机制,确保数据在强电磁干扰环境下稳定传输,单条总线支持最多 110 个节点,通信波特率最高可达 1Mbps(短距离)。
实时性强:通过 ID 优先级仲裁,高优先级数据(如紧急停机指令)可优先传输,满足工业控制对毫秒级响应的需求。
灵活扩展:支持标准帧(11 位 ID)与扩展帧(29 位 ID),兼容 Modbus RTU、CANOpen、J1939 等高层协议,适配复杂工业场景。
二、稳格智造 CAN 上位机开发服务:全场景覆盖,定制化交付
稳格智造以“稳定、高效、易用”为设计原则,提供从硬件适配到软件功能的全流程开发服务,核心模块包括:
1. 协议解析与通信驱动开发
多协议支持:兼容 Modbus RTU、CANOpen、J1939 等主流工业协议,支持自定义协议解析,快速适配老旧设备与非标系统。
硬件抽象层(HAL):通过抽象工厂模式封装不同厂商 CAN 适配器(如 PCAN、USB-CAN、Kvaser)的差异,上层应用无需关心底层硬件细节,提升代码复用率。
高性能通信:采用多线程生产者-消费者模型处理 CAN 帧收发,支持高并发场景下的数据丢包率低于 0.1%,确保实时性。
2. 数据采集与可视化界面设计
动态仪表盘:基于 Qt/WPF 框架开发高响应界面,支持实时曲线、柱状图、数字仪表等组件,直观展示设备状态(如温度、压力、转速)。
历史数据查询:集成 SQLite 数据库,支持按时间、设备 ID、数据类型等条件查询历史记录,并导出 CSV/Excel 格式文件。
报警阈值设置:用户可自定义数据上下限,当采集值超限时,系统通过弹窗、声音、短信等方式触发多级报警。
3. 边缘计算与智能分析
4. 远程监控与云平台集成
5. 国产化生态适配与安全加固
三、典型应用场景
智能工厂:连接 PLC、传感器、机器人等设备,实时采集生产数据,优化工艺流程,降低次品率。
新能源汽车:通过 CAN 上位机监控电池管理系统(BMS),实时显示电压、电流曲线,保障充电安全。
轨道交通:解析列车控制单元(TCU)的 CAN 数据,实现远程故障诊断与运维调度。
能源管理:在风电、光伏等场景中,采集逆变器、电表等设备数据,支持能源调度与碳足迹追踪。
四、技术优势与保障
模块化架构:采用分层设计(物理层、会话层、协议层、交互存储层、表示层),降低系统复杂度,便于功能扩展与维护。
跨平台支持:开发的上位机软件支持 Windows/Linux/macOS 及嵌入式系统,满足不同场景需求。
全流程服务:从需求分析、架构设计到编码实现、测试部署,提供一站式服务,并通过 Jira 系统实时同步开发进度。
持续优化:提供 3 年免费维护服务,包括软件升级、故障排查与操作培训,结合预测性维护算法提前预警潜在问题。
五、未来展望:CAN 与 5G/TSN 的融合创新
稳格智造将持续探索 CAN 通信与前沿技术的结合:
5G+CAN:通过 5G 模组实现 CAN 设备无线化,支持低时延(<10ms)、高可靠(99.999%)的远程控制,适用于移动机器人、AGV 等场景。
TSN 集成:将 CAN 数据映射至时间敏感网络(TSN),实现微秒级同步与确定性传输,满足工业自动化对实时性的严苛要求。
数字孪生联动:构建“设备-CAN 上位机-数字孪生体”闭环系统,通过实时数据驱动虚拟模型,优化生产流程与设备维护策略。
在工业智能化转型的浪潮中,稳格智造 CAN 通信上位机开发服务正以“稳定、高效、安全”为核心价值,助力企业突破通信瓶颈,释放数据潜能,迈向智能制造的新高度。